I know I've got a little while to go before I need to worry about this, but my DH and I were wondering about when people start to make the permanent switch from a bottle to a cup. Right now I give my DS his bottle upon awaking from sleeps/naps, then food ~1hr later, and that system works great for now, but when (approx) do the 'bottle feedings' stop and the cup becomes the liquid feeder of choice? We switched from bottle of formula to sippy cup of water during the day first (around 10 months i think...) Once soldis were fully established, we offered them first, with a cup of water, then milk afterwards.  She started to drink less and less, then refused the milk altogether.
The formula in the morning was replaced with cows milk a around 1 year and put into one of her suppy cups. We got lucky wth the bedtime bottle as she had a tummy bug and refused it 3 nights running, so we switched that for a cup of milk too (15 months)

WE stopped bottles cold turkey about one week after ds first birthday when we ran out of formula and switched to milk.  He did fine with it and forgot about the bottle pretty quick although it did take a while to get his milk consumption up which I think had more to do with the change to milk than the change to the cup.
